Halogen bond anion templated assembly of an imidazolium pseudorotaxane.
- Abstract:
- Halogen bonding has been exploited in the assembly of an interpenetrated molecular system. The strength of chloride-anion-templated pseudorotaxane formation with a 2-bromo-functionalized imidazolium threading component and an isophthalamide macrocycle (see picture) is significantly enhanced compared to hydrogen-bonded pseudorotaxane analogues.
